Local Clinics & Sensory Resources in Normal

Carle BroMenn Medical Center — Rehabilitation Services

Full-service hospital rehab department offering occupational therapy, physical therapy, and hand therapy for McLean County residents, with specialized programs for pediatric development and adult neurological conditions.

Marcfirst

McLean County developmental services agency providing early intervention, developmental therapy, and family support for children with disabilities from birth through age three, with a strong referral network into school-based services.

ISU Psychology Clinic

University-affiliated assessment and therapy clinic staffed by doctoral students under licensed supervision, offering neuropsychological evaluations, ADHD assessments, and therapeutic services at reduced cost to the community.

The Baby Fold

Bloomington-Normal nonprofit providing therapeutic foster care, residential treatment, and developmental services for children with behavioral and emotional challenges, including sensory-informed approaches to trauma care.

McLean County Center for Human Services

Community mental health center serving McLean County with outpatient therapy, crisis services, and child and adolescent programs that incorporate sensory strategies into behavioral health treatment.

Normal Parks & Recreation — Adaptive Programs

Municipal recreation programs offering inclusive and adaptive activities for individuals with disabilities, including sensory-friendly events and therapeutic recreation partnerships with local clinics.

Unit 5 Schools — Special Education Services

Normal's Unit 5 school district provides comprehensive special education services including school-based OT, speech therapy, and counseling for students with IEPs, serving over 13,000 students across the district.

Illinois State University Speech and Hearing Clinic

University clinic providing speech-language pathology and audiology services with sensory-informed approaches, serving children and adults in the Bloomington-Normal community at reduced rates.

Practitioner Associations & Community Groups

McLean County families access support through the Autism Society of Illinois for statewide advocacy and resources, the McLean County Special Education Association for school-based support coordination, the ISU Special Education department for research-informed community partnerships, Easter Seals Central Illinois for therapy and family programming, and the Bloomington-Normal NAMI chapter for mental health education and family support groups.
